3. Paper Size Detection

The paper size dial controls side post positioning and paper size detection.
When the paper size dial [A] is rotated, the cam groove [B] moves the size
lever [C], which repositions the guide posts [D]. When the dial reaches a
standard paper size, one of the actuator plates [E] enters the paper size
sensor [F]. At the same time, the pin [G] on the leaf spring [H] drops into a
notch on the inside rim of the dial and the positioning switch [1] deactuates.
When the positioning switch opens, the scan signal is applied to the LCT
paper size sensor. The paper size sensor then reads the pattern of the
actuator plate and sends paper size data to the copier's CPU.
When the paper size dial is positioned at a non-standard paper size, the
positioning switch is actuated (closed). In this case, the LCT cannot be used;
the Load Paper indicator lights and no paper size is displayed on the
operation panel. This prevents the skewing that would occur if the guide
posts were not at the correct position.
